Shirley M. VanVooren, 91, of Durant, formerly of Atkinson, died on Tuesday, June 25, 2019, at Genesis Medical Center, East Campus in Davenport.

A funeral service celebrating her life was held at 11 a.m. on Tuesday, July 2 at Vandemore Funeral Homes & Crematory – Atkinson Chapel. Deacon Nick Simon lead the celebration. Burial followed at St. Anthony Cemetery.

Visitation was held from 10 until 11 a.m. on Tuesday at the funeral home.

Shirley was born on July 19, 1927, the daughter of Mel and Elizabeth (VandeVoorde) Carton, in Annawan. Shirley was united in marriage to Robert VanVooren on Nov. 24, 1951, in Atkinson. He preceded her in death on July 15, 2013.

She was employed at the Wilton Community Bank as a teller for eight years and a librarian for the Scott County Association in New Liberty.

She enjoyed spending time with her family, playing bridge, jigsaw puzzles and doing crossword puzzles. Shirley loved to fish. She was a member of Our Lady of Victory Catholic Church in Davenport.

Shirley is remembered by her daughters: Vicki (Gary) Neumann of Durant, Noreen (Russ) Price of Durant and Sherry Turkal of Port Byron; her son, Craig (Julie) VanVooren of Moline; seven grandchildren; five great-grandchildren; sisters, Rita (Wayne ) Olson of Cambridge, Illinois and Roberta Zorza of Grants Pass, Oregan; and brother, Lawrence (Lois) Carton of Geneseo.

Shirley was preceded in death by her husband Robert, four brothers and one sister.
